Last year's elections brought to light, Mr. Speaker, troubling deficiencies in our electoral system, leaving many Americans disillusioned about our democracy itself. We are all, of course, painfully aware of the tragedy in Florida, which culminated on this very day 1 year ago. But the problem was clearly larger than that, so the Democratic Caucus' Special Committee on Election Reform, under the able leadership of the gentlewoman from California (Ms. Waters), spent much of the past year conducting field hearings in communities around the Nation. The committee confirmed what so many others have found; that America's electoral system is broken, and that Americans from coast to coast have been disenfranchised in every election. In my own Congressional District in Fort Worth, Texas last year, I personally witnessed and fought against a systematic partisan campaign to harass, intimidate, and suppress African American voters, especially senior citizens. For all these reasons, real election reform is a priority for the American people, and it is a passion for Democrats. But protecting every American's right to vote should not be a partisan issue. It is the cornerstone to rebuilding faith in our democracy, and it is the civil rights issue of the new millennium.
